Best Radio, Television, and Digital Communication Schools in Ohio

Ohio has 9 colleges offering Radio, Television, and Digital Communication programs tracked by the College Scorecard, producing 557 recent graduates. Graduates in Ohio earn $28,734 on average within two years — 6% below the national average of $30,432. Lower cost of living or industry mix may explain the gap.

School choice matters significantly: Miami University-Oxford graduates earn $45,696 while Youngstown State University graduates earn $19,592 — a $26,104 gap. Research each program's curriculum, employer connections, and career services before deciding.

Public vs Private: Radio, Television, and Digital Communication in Ohio

Public Schools (6)
$29,905
avg. 2yr earnings
Private Schools (3)
$26,393
avg. 2yr earnings

Public schools in Ohio produce comparable or higher early earnings for Radio, Television, and Digital Communication graduates, often at lower cost — making them strong value options.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best school for Radio, Television, and Digital Communication in Ohio?
Miami University-Oxford ranks #1 for Radio, Television, and Digital Communication in Ohio with median graduate earnings of $45,696 within two years of graduation. There are 9 schools offering Radio, Television, and Digital Communication programs in the state.
How much do Radio, Television, and Digital Communication graduates earn in Ohio?
Radio, Television, and Digital Communication graduates in Ohio earn an average of $28,734 within two years of graduation. This is 6% below the national average of $30,432 for this major.
What is the hardest Radio, Television, and Digital Communication school to get into in Ohio?
Cedarville University is the most selective Radio, Television, and Digital Communication program in Ohio with an acceptance rate of 62.8%. The average acceptance rate across Radio, Television, and Digital Communication programs in the state is 78.8%.
Should I attend a public or private school for Radio, Television, and Digital Communication in Ohio?
In Ohio, private Radio, Television, and Digital Communication programs produce average earnings of $26,393 vs $29,905 at public schools. However, public schools typically cost less — consider net price relative to earnings when calculating ROI. There are 6 public and 3 private options in the state.
